The External Muon Identifier (EMI) developed by the University of Hawaii-Lawrence Berkeley Laboratory collaboration for use with the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ory 15' hydrogen bubble chamber consists of a layer of dense absorbing material followed by a layer of multiwire proportional chambers (MWPC). One algorithm developed for the reduction of the data recorded by the EMI to yield x-y coordinates of particle penetrations through the sensitive plane is described.
